Hi everyone, my name is now Aureus, which is Latin and the main gold coin of ancient Rome. I am a young male pup, and I was found as a stray along a turnpike with no homes in sight. A nice woman saw me running, scared, and pulled over to chase me through an abandoned industrial building for 45 minutes. When she caught me, she saw I was tired, dirty, and covered in ticks. She took me to a vet, cleaned me up, and reported me as a found pup. Based on my puppy teeth, I am about 2 -3 months old. Within a week, I took a long trip to Shiba HQ. I got sick a few times on our drive, but otherwise did well. Once I arrived at Shiba HQ, I got to explore the yard on my own, then met all the friendly dogs and cats. I do great with all the animals. My foster mom noticed that I am terrified to potty in front of people. This usually means punishment for pottying indoors, which generalizes to punishing all pottying. DC SIR uses reward-based training, so I am using a puppy pad inside while I learn to potty outside with rewards. I am slowly building confidence. I was just 15lbs when I was rescued, and in just a week, I have gained nearly 3lbs! I have big paws, and the vets think I may weigh 45–55 lbs! I may be a Shepherd/Shiba mix – we’ll see – but I am definitely going to be a big boy! I am doing well on walks, but if my foster mom takes me too far from the house, I get scared. On our first walk, I pulled away and ran straight home to the backyard gate. I thought she was going to dump me! I am learning to trust people and will need adopters who are willing to build a trusting bond with me!
